--- Comment #7 from Stefan Dösinger stefan@codeweavers.com --- I have seen the same issue on the Starcraft 2 arcade map "Squadron TD Beta". It doesn't manifest as a crash, but outlines around certain buildings and units are red when the mouse hovers over them. Using native d3dcompiler works around the issue.
Compile output seems to be cached somewhere, so switching from/to native d3dcompiler doesn't immediately change the user-visible behavior. Various Starcraft 2 directories in C:\users and C:\ProgramData need to be deleted.
Bugs 44920 and 52244 seem to be duplicates of this bug with slightly different symptoms.
